Civil society organisations have trained 15,000 Nigerian youths on green economy and digital skills to improve employability and job readiness.
The training programme was delivered by Young Advocates for a Sustainable and Inclusive Future Nigeria, the International Association for Volunteer Effort, and International Business Machines Corporation.
Programme Focus and Goals
Organisers said the initiative aims to prepare young people for opportunities in the green and digital economies. The programme focuses on practical skills that match current labour market needs.
Participants received training through IBM SkillsBuild, a global digital learning platform that provides access to professional, technical, and sustainability skills.
SkillsBuild Programme in Africa
In Africa, the SkillsBuild programme operates under the Reskilling Revolution Africa initiative. The programme runs through partnerships involving IAVE, IBM, and the African Union.
National civil society partners coordinate the programme at the country level. The digital platform allows self-paced learning, tracks progress, and awards internationally recognised digital credentials.
Success of Pilot Phase in Nigeria
Nigeria recorded strong results during the pilot phase of the programme. More than 12,000 young people enrolled, exceeding the initial target.
Most participants came from unemployed and underemployed groups, including students in tertiary and technical institutions. Female participation also exceeded expectations.
Learners completed about 93,000 learning hours and earned nearly 2,000 digital credentials.
Expansion Under Phase Two
Following the pilot success, organisers launched Phase Two of the programme. This phase targets the enrolment of 15,000 young Nigerians over 12 months.
At least half of the participants are expected to be women. Training will take place in Abuja, Lagos, Kaduna, Katsina, and Niger State.
Learning Model and Skill Areas
Participants will join weekly learning groups through a blended approach. This model combines online lessons with in-person coaching, mentoring, and peer support.
The training covers climate change, green economy skills, digital marketing, artificial intelligence, web development, project management, entrepreneurship, and sustainability.
Employability and Volunteer Support
The programme also includes employability support such as CV writing, interview preparation, and job placement partnerships.
Entrepreneurship training and mentorship support participants interested in self-employment. Volunteers play a key role by helping learners apply their skills through community projects.
